Description of the Invention: [Technical Field] [0001] The present invention relates to a housing, and more particularly to a housing having a snap-fit structure. [Prior Art] [0002] An electronic device such as a housing of a display generally includes a first housing, a second housing, and a snap-fit structure that detachably assembles the first housing to the second housing. The first outer casing may be combined with the second outer casing to enclose a receiving space for receiving the electronic component. Generally, the engaging structure includes a plurality of hooks disposed on the first outer casing, and a card slot disposed on the second outer casing corresponding to the plurality of hooks. The first outer casing and the second outer casing can be assembled by snapping a plurality of hooks and a plurality of card slots. [0003] However, when the user needs to repair the electronic component, the user needs to apply an external force to elastically deform the side wall of the first outer casing or the side wall of the second outer casing to separate the plurality of hooks from the plurality of card slots, thereby The outer casing is separated from the second outer casing and is relatively easy to damage the casing of the electronic device.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ION [0004] In view of the above, it is necessary to provide a casing that can reduce damage during the disassembly process. A housing includes a first outer casing, a second outer casing, and a snap-fit structure that detachably assembles the first outer casing to the second outer casing. The engaging structure includes a fastening unit disposed on the first housing and a hook unit disposed on the second housing. The fastening unit includes a first fastening portion and a first magnetic body received in the first fastening portion, and the hook unit includes a first hook and a second magnetic body received in the hook. A magnetic body and a second magnetic body 098120761 Form No. A0101 Page 4 of 17 Page 0982035372-0 201101956 [0006] Ο [0007] Ο [0008] [0009] 098120761 The opposite-face polarity is opposite 'the hook unit can be The first magnetic body translates with respect to the second magnetic body and drives the first hook to translate toward the first fastening portion and engages with the first fastening portion, and applies an external force to push the second The housing is translated relative to the first-shell to separate the first magnetic body and the second magnetic body from being driven by the second outer casing to translate the first hook away from the first engaging portion and to be separated from the first engaging portion. The housing 'only needs to apply an external force to displace the second housing relative to the first housing and simultaneously drive the hook unit to translate relative to the first housing and separate from the fastening unit' to disassemble the first housing from the second housing without The external force is applied to elastically deform the first outer casing or the second outer casing, so that damage to the casing during the disassembly process can be reduced relative to the prior art.
